"""
Flask-OpenID
============
Adds OpenID support to Flask.
Links:
* `Flask-OpenID Documentation <http://packages.python.org/Flask-OpenID/>`_
* `Flask <http://flask.pocoo.org>`_
* `development version
<http://github.com/mitsuhiko/flask-openid/zipball/master#egg=Flask-OpenID-dev>`_
"""
from setuptools import setup
import sys
import os
# This check is to make sure we checkout docs/_themes before running sdist
if not os.path.exists("./docs/_themes/README"):
print('Please make sure you have docs/_themes checked out while running setup.py!')
if os.path.exists('.git'):
print('You seem to be using a git checkout, please execute the following commands to get the docs/_themes directory:')
print(' - git submodule init')
print(' - git submodule update')
else:
print('You seem to be using a release. Please use the release tarball from PyPI instead of the archive from GitHub')
sys.exit(1)
if sys.version_info[0] >= 3:
install_requires = ['Flask>=0.10.1', 'python3-openid>=2.0']
else:
install_requires = ['Flask>=0.3', 'python-openid>=2.0']
setup(
name='Flask-OpenID',
version='1.2.6',
url='http://github.com/mitsuhiko/flask-openid/',
license='BSD',
author='Armin Ronacher, Patrick Uiterwijk',
author_email='armin.ronacher@active-4.com, puiterwijk@redhat.com',
description='OpenID support for Flask',
long_description=__doc__,
py_modules=['flask_openid'],
zip_safe=False,
platforms='any',
install_requires=install_requires,
classifiers=[
'Development Status :: 4 - Beta',
'Environment :: Web Environment',
'Intended Audience :: Developers',
'License :: OSI Approved :: BSD License',
'Operating System :: OS Independent',
'Programming Language :: Python',
'Topic :: Internet :: WWW/HTTP :: Dynamic Content',
'Topic :: Software Development :: Libraries :: Python Modules'
]
)
